Basic Info
The Non Profit Apprenticeship (NPA) program at Free Geek is designed to provide capable individuals with relevant experience to succeed in the non-profit world. These apprenticeships are a great opportunity to gain experience:
- in a hands-on teaching environment
- coordinating a diversity and large number of volunteers
- collaborating with others to improve processes and make volunteers even happier
- working at a busy non-profit
Each apprentice cross-trains at the Front Desk, Hardware Donations, Prebuild, and Recycling, and works together with the other apprentices to improve these areas collaboratively.
Responsibilities
General Responsibilities for All Areas
- Train, supervise, coordinate, and motivate volunteers
- Give tours to potential volunteers
- Learn about Free Geek's programs to accurately field questions
- Proactively communicate with other Free Geek staff, especially other apprentices, and volunteers about the needs of all areas
- Attend NPA committee and Front Desk committee meetings, rotating through facilitator and scribe roles
- Keep abreast of relevant (and frequent) emails
- Help keep areas in line with Free Geek philosophy and capabilities
- Undergo intensive initial training
- Assist in training your replacement at the end of your apprenticeship
Front Desk Area
- Greet visitors
- Answer a multi-line phone, check & relay messages to appropriate places
- Accept & process donations
- Perform data entry
- Use a cash register
- Process till at the end of the day
- Schedule volunteer shifts accurately
- Make reminder calls to volunteers for upcoming classes
- Prioritize lobby visitors appropriately
- Print volunteer handouts daily
- Maintain a steady stream of available coffee for volunteers
- Take on additional daily tasks at Front Desk as necessary
Hardware Donations Area
- Manage flow of gizmos through the hardware donations receiving area
- Teach Adoption volunteers basic intake procedures
- Ensure that Hardware Donations is well integrated with Free Geeks production and sales areas
Prebuild Area
- Teach basic hardware vocabulary and Free Geek's system evaluation process to Build volunteers as needed (we will train you)
- Schedule volunteer shifts accurately
Recycling Area
- Help keep Recycling area clean and free of obstructions
- Ensure that volunteers are safely disassembling gizmos
- Communicate with Hardware Donations throughout the day
- Identify and act on priorities in recycling flow
- Assist in setting up pick-ups and deliveries with e-waste vendors
* Unload and load trucks as needed (after forklift training)
- Assist in warehouse management
Required Skills
- Be able to maintain a positive and professional attitude at all times in a sometimes chaotic environment
- Experience coordinating and/or instructing people
- Aptitude for and enjoyment of helping people
- Interest in non-profit operations and management
- Strong organizational skills (you like to put stuff in order)
- Communicate, fluently, in English
- Good interpersonal skills
- Self-motivated and takes initiative
- Proficiency with using e-mail and Internet
- Ability to learn Free Geek documentation tools (RT and wiki)
- Comfortable with and capable of coordinating others
- Be reliable & on-time
- Detail-oriented
- Able to lift and carry at least 50 pounds on a regular basis
Extra Credit
- Interest in e-waste recycling practices
- Money-handling experience
- Fluency in another language
- Warehouse experience
* Forklift experience, but will train
In Addition
The ideal candidate will be able to work well under stress in a somewhat chaotic setting and maintain a positive attitude. The candidate will not be afraid to ask questions, and will be able to remain flexible as Free Geek grows and changes.
